Abstract
一次性标本留取及接种器,包括留取容器和用于密封容器的密封盖,密封盖的内侧面中央固定一内套管,所述内套管底部固定有接种环和可在管内上下移动的棉签;棉签的尾部设有限定棉签位置的限位支架,在中空管的内壁上设有与限位支架配合起位置限定作用的卡环;限位支架的末端连接有用于拉动其越过卡环从而使棉签缩进中空管的牵引线,牵引线穿过密封盖后与用于牵引操作的拉环连接。本实用新型使提取标本和接种画线一次性完成,用完即弃,免去在酒精灯上烧红接种环以到达灭菌的过程,不仅避免交叉污染且节省时间提高工作效率。
Disposable sample collection and inoculation device, including a collection container and a sealing cover for sealing the container. An inner sleeve is fixed in the center of the inner surface of the sealing cover. The bottom of the inner sleeve is fixed with an inoculation ring and can move up and down in the tube Cotton swab; the tail of the cotton swab is provided with a limit bracket to limit the position of the cotton swab, and the inner wall of the hollow tube is provided with a snap ring that cooperates with the limit bracket to limit the position; The ring is used to retract the cotton swab into the pulling wire of the hollow tube, and the pulling wire passes through the sealing cover and is connected with the pull ring for pulling operation. The utility model can complete the extraction of specimens and inoculation and line drawing at one time, and can be discarded after use, eliminating the process of burning the inoculation loop on the alcohol lamp to achieve sterilization, which not only avoids cross-contamination, but also saves time and improves work efficiency.

背景技术 Background technique
临床检验是将病人的血液、体液、分泌物、排泄物和脱落物等标本,运用物理学、化学和生物学等的实验方法对各种标本进行定性或定量分析,以获得反映机体功能状态、病理变化或病因等的客观资料。因此,临床检验对患者的后期治疗及药物的选择十分重要。 Clinical examination is the qualitative or quantitative analysis of various samples of blood, body fluids, secretions, excretions and sheds of patients, using experimental methods such as physics, chemistry and biology, in order to obtain information that reflects the functional state of the body, Objective data of pathological changes or etiology, etc. Therefore, clinical testing is very important for the later treatment of patients and the selection of drugs.
临床上,在标本接种过程中需要先蘸取标本,之后在培养平板上接种。而为了培养得到清晰明确的菌落,通常需要采用接种环划线接种。在接种前还要将接种环在酒精灯上烧红进行消毒,然后才能进行接种等操作步骤。以往使用的标本留取容器较深,提取标本时要想取到标本要将接种环甚至手柄都伸到留取容器中才能取到标本,使手柄被标本污染,加之手柄不易在酒精灯彻底烧红消毒杀菌,故将医务人员手套也污染,极易造成标本之间交叉污染。对于痰液等标本,由于标本较稀,用接种环提取时附着在接种环上的标本量很少,难以完成接种。此时,就需要用棉签等工具先把标本提取出来,再用接种环接种。这需要多次取用器械,导致操作繁琐,效率低。 Clinically, in the process of specimen inoculation, it is necessary to dip the specimen first, and then inoculate it on the culture plate. In order to obtain clear and distinct colonies, it is usually necessary to use an inoculation loop to streak the inoculation. Before inoculation, the inoculation loop should be burned red on the alcohol lamp for disinfection, and then the operation steps such as inoculation can be carried out. The specimen collection container used in the past was relatively deep. When extracting the specimen, the inoculation loop and even the handle must be extended into the collection container to obtain the specimen. The handle is contaminated by the specimen, and the handle is not easy to burn completely in the alcohol lamp. Red disinfection and sterilization, so the gloves of medical staff are also contaminated, which can easily cause cross-contamination between specimens. For samples such as sputum, because the sample is relatively thin, the amount of sample attached to the inoculation loop is very small when it is extracted with the inoculation loop, and it is difficult to complete the inoculation. At this time, it is necessary to use tools such as cotton swabs to extract the specimen first, and then use the inoculation loop to inoculate. This requires multiple access to instruments, resulting in cumbersome operations and low efficiency.
实用新型内容 Utility model content
本实用新型的目的是为解决上述技术问题的不足,提供一种将标本留取和接种画线一次完成的一次性标本留取及接种器。 The purpose of this utility model is to solve the deficiency of the above-mentioned technical problems, and to provide a disposable specimen collection and inoculator which completes specimen collection and inoculation drawing at one time.
本实用新型为解决上述技术问题所采用的技术方案是:一次性标本留取及接种器,包括留取容器和用于密封容器的密封盖,密封盖的内侧面中央固定一内套管,所述内套管沿其径向分为两部分,一部分底部固定有用于划线接种的接种环,另一部分为中空管,所述中空管内设置有一个可在中空管内上下移动的用于沾取标本的棉签;所述棉签的尾部设有限定棉签位置的限位支架,在中空管的内壁上设有与限位支架配合起位置限定作用的卡环;所述限位支架的末端连接有用于拉动其越过卡环从而使棉签缩进中空管的牵引线,牵引线穿过密封盖后与用于牵引操作的拉环连接。 The technical solution adopted by the utility model for solving the above-mentioned technical problems is: a disposable sample retention and inoculation device, including a retention container and a sealing cover for sealing the container, and an inner casing is fixed in the center of the inner surface of the sealing cover, so The inner casing is divided into two parts along its radial direction, one part is fixed with an inoculation ring for marking inoculation at the bottom, and the other part is a hollow tube, and a device for dipping is arranged in the hollow tube which can move up and down in the hollow tube. The cotton swab of the sample; the tail of the cotton swab is provided with a limit bracket to limit the position of the cotton swab, and the inner wall of the hollow tube is provided with a snap ring that cooperates with the limit bracket to limit the position; The pulling wire is used to pull it over the snap ring so that the cotton swab retracts into the hollow tube, and the pulling wire passes through the sealing cover and is connected with the pulling ring for pulling operation.
本实用新型所述棉签在伸出中空管的状态下,接种环和棉签的头部均靠近留取容器底部。 When the cotton swab of the utility model stretches out from the hollow tube, the heads of the inoculation loop and the cotton swab are all close to the bottom of the storage container.
本实用新型所述棉签在缩进中空管的状态下,接种环头部到留取容器底部的距离小于棉签的头部到留取容器底部的距离。 When the cotton swab of the utility model is retracted into the hollow tube, the distance from the head of the inoculation loop to the bottom of the storage container is smaller than the distance from the head of the cotton swab to the bottom of the storage container.
本实用新型所述的限位支架由两个呈V形连接的支撑部构成,牵引线的一端具有分别与两个支撑部连接的分叉,所述限位支架的两个支撑部能够在牵引线的牵拉下相靠拢,从而使限位支架越过卡环。 The space-limiting bracket described in the utility model is composed of two supporting parts connected in a V shape, and one end of the pulling wire has bifurcations connected with the two supporting parts respectively, and the two supporting parts of the space-limiting bracket can be pulled Under the pulling of the line, they move closer to each other, so that the limit bracket goes over the snap ring.
本实用新型的有益效果是:本实用新型将接种环和棉签均通过内套管固定在密封盖上,使提取标本和接种画线一次性完成,用完即弃,免去在酒精灯上烧红接种环以到达灭菌的过程,不仅避免交叉污染且节省时间提高工作效率;同时棉签可在内套管内通过牵引线和拉环的作用移动,使棉签将标本提取出涂在培养平板后将密封盖外的牵引线向外拉,棉签可向上移动缩进内套管中而使棉签头部高于接种环头部位置,从而可用一次性接种环蘸取培养平板上的标本在旁边进行画线,方便快捷;本实用新型将接种环和棉签的头部均靠近留取容器底部,避免因标本太少或液面过低而无法取到标本,操作方便简单。 The beneficial effects of the utility model are: the utility model fixes the inoculation loop and the cotton swab on the sealing cover through the inner sleeve, so that the extraction of the specimen and the inoculation line can be completed at one time, and they can be discarded after use, eliminating the need to burn them on the alcohol lamp. The red inoculation loop is used to achieve the sterilization process, which not only avoids cross-contamination but also saves time and improves work efficiency; at the same time, the cotton swab can be moved through the pulling wire and pull ring in the inner sleeve, so that the cotton swab can extract the specimen and spread it on the culture plate. The traction line outside the sealing cover is pulled outward, and the cotton swab can be moved upwards and retracted into the inner sleeve so that the head of the cotton swab is higher than the head of the inoculation loop, so that the disposable inoculation loop can be used to dip the specimen on the culture plate and draw next to it. Line, convenient and fast; the utility model puts the head of the inoculation loop and the cotton swab close to the bottom of the storage container, so as to avoid the inability to take the specimen due to too few specimens or the liquid level is too low, and the operation is convenient and simple.
